Global Ingestible Thermometers Market (USD Million), 2021 - 2031
In the year 2024, the Global Ingestible Thermometers Market was valued at USD 58.99 million. The size of this market is expected to increase to USD 130.41 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 12.0%%.
The Global Ingestible Thermometers Market represents a dynamic sector within the broader healthcare industry, offering innovative solutions for monitoring body temperature. Ingestible thermometers, also known as temperature pills or capsules, are ingestible sensors that accurately measure core body temperature. These devices have gained significant traction due to their non-invasive nature and potential for continuous monitoring, particularly in situations where traditional methods like oral, axillary, or rectal thermometers are impractical or uncomfortable. The market encompasses a range of products designed for diverse applications, including medical diagnostics, sports performance monitoring, and wellness tracking.
Driven by advancements in sensor technology and miniaturization, the global market for ingestible thermometers has witnessed substantial growth in recent years. These devices offer numerous advantages over conventional temperature monitoring methods, such as convenience, real-time data transmission, and improved patient compliance. Additionally, the rising prevalence of chronic diseases and the growing emphasis on remote patient monitoring have spurred demand for ingestible thermometers, particularly in geriatric care and home healthcare settings. Furthermore, the COVID-19 pandemic has underscored the importance of accurate temperature monitoring in healthcare settings, further propelling the adoption of these innovative devices.

Global Ingestible Thermometers Market , Segmentation by Application
The Global Ingestible Thermometers Market has been segmented by Application into Chemotherapy treatment, Surgical, Gastrointestinal, Sleep disorder analysis, Tropical medicine, Veterinary, Diseases diagnosis, Sports and Others.
The Ingestible Thermometers Market is segmented by application into several key areas: Chemotherapy Treatment, Surgical, Gastrointestinal, Sleep Disorder Analysis, Tropical Medicine, Veterinary, Disease Diagnosis, Sports, and Others. In the context of chemotherapy treatment, ingestible thermometers are invaluable for monitoring the body temperature of cancer patients, who are often at risk for febrile neutropenia—a potentially life-threatening side effect. Continuous and accurate temperature monitoring helps in the early detection of infections, allowing for timely medical intervention. Similarly, in surgical applications, these thermometers provide precise core temperature measurements during and after surgical procedures, which is critical for preventing hypothermia or hyperthermia and ensuring optimal patient outcomes.
Gastrointestinal applications of ingestible thermometers involve tracking internal body temperature to diagnose and manage conditions such as irritable bowel syndrome (IBS) and inflammatory bowel disease (IBD). These devices offer a non-invasive method to gather essential data, improving diagnostic accuracy and treatment efficacy. Sleep disorder analysis is another significant application, where ingestible thermometers help in studying core body temperature variations that can impact sleep patterns, aiding in the diagnosis and treatment of disorders like insomnia and sleep apnea. In tropical medicine, these devices are used to monitor patients for diseases prevalent in tropical climates, such as malaria or dengue fever, where accurate temperature monitoring is crucial for managing fever symptoms.
The veterinary application of ingestible thermometers extends their use to animals, where they are employed to monitor the health of pets and livestock, providing veterinarians with a non-invasive tool for accurate temperature measurement. For disease diagnosis, these thermometers are utilized in various clinical settings to detect fever as a symptom of infections or other health conditions, facilitating early diagnosis and treatment. In sports, athletes use ingestible thermometers to monitor core body temperature during training and competitions, helping to prevent heat-related illnesses and optimize performance. The 'Others' category encompasses a range of additional applications, including research and development in medical and scientific fields, where these devices are used to gather precise physiological data. Each application segment underscores the versatility and critical importance of ingestible thermometers in advancing healthcare and wellness across diverse domains.
